Fig. 2: ZNF24 was the critical target of ZNFTR in PC.
From: LncRNA ZNFTR functions as an inhibitor in pancreatic cancer by modulating ATF3/ZNF24/VEGFA pathway

A The schematic diagram showed the position relationship between ZNFTR and ZNF24. The data were searched from the UCSC Genome Browser. B After transfected with siNC or siZNFTR #1/2, and pcDNA-Vector or pcDNA-ZNFTR in BxPC-3 and PANC-1 cells, the expression of ZNF24 both at mRNA and protein levels was detected by qRT-PCR and western blot, respectively. C After co-transfected with pcDNA-ZNFTR and siNC/siZNF24 or co-transfected with siZNFTR and pcDNA-vector/pcDNA-ZNF24 in PANC-1 cells, the expression of ZNF24 both at mRNA and protein levels was measured by qRT-PCR and western blot, respectively. D After co-transfected with siZNFTR and pcDNA-vector/pcDNA-ZNF24 or co-transfected with pcDNA-ZNFTR and siNC/siZNF24 in PANC-1 cells, the proliferation of transfected PANC-1 cells was analyzed via CCK-8 assay for 5 days. E, F To assess the invasive and migrative abilities of PANC-1 cells, co-transfected with pcDNA-ZNFTR and siNC/siZNF24 or co-transfected with siZNFTR and pcDNA-vector/pcDNA-ZNF24, Transwell assay (E) and Wound healing (F) were conducted, respectively. The histograms were showed as quantized relative invaded cells or wound size. Five fields were selected randomly and averaged. All data were revealed as means ± standard deviation (SD) for no less than three independent experiments. Significant P values showed as *P < 0.05, **P < 0.01, and ***P < 0.001.
